I'd be a bit more careful about the comparison with alpha-beta in
section 2.3. I believe that iterative deepening of alpha-beta is very
common. It can be argued that when iterative deepening is used, an
early termination isn't very detrimental. I've seen people get
completely turned off to a paper simply because they compare their
carefully optimized results to a poor implementation of some other
algorithm (ie. alpha beta).

Now my feeling is that the "improving random simulations" part of this
work is
promising. We have only done very few steps in this direction, and it
gives
quite convincing results. It was what I meant in the "random
distribution"
discussions we have in this list. I am pretty sure that making
improvements
in this direction would increase a lot the level of MC players even (or
especially) in 19x19. And this can be done very soon (well, perhaps not
before sunday :)).
